頁面性能監控 很多公司都會做頁面性能的檢測,做的方法也非常多。其實比較簡單的是利用js去做,js可以很方便的調取瀏覽器的api,獲取network里的相關信息,這個資料還是比較多的。唯一的難點在於如何注入js腳本,業內的方法的普遍有兩種 利用selenium ...
我們在使用Selenium測試Web或Electronjs Cef框架應用時,有時候操作一個元素需要判斷是否發送了請求以及請求的參數是否正確 我們可以通過,開啟Chrome的性能日志來然后配合driver.get log performance 來查看請求,然后對Network相關的日子進行過濾, 實現如下: 獲取Chrome性能日志 運行結果如下: 獲取請求及響應信息 由於日志中沒有接口后台數據 ...
2021-07-17 14:02 0 297 推薦指數:
頁面性能監控 很多公司都會做頁面性能的檢測,做的方法也非常多。其實比較簡單的是利用js去做,js可以很方便的調取瀏覽器的api,獲取network里的相關信息,這個資料還是比較多的。唯一的難點在於如何注入js腳本,業內的方法的普遍有兩種 利用selenium ...
有更簡單的方式,不用這么復雜的,自行百度 本文僅是獲取驗證碼圖片,python+selenium實現 圖片的處理,算出偏移位置網上都有現成的;而由於b站的更新,圖片的獲取則與之前完全不同,不能直接從html中拿到 過程比較曲折所以記錄一下,可能比較長 從分析的過程來展開 ...
配置(一般無需修改端口號,除非和其他應用的端口沖突,比如8888端口被占用了) 在如下設置中可以手動配 ...
在我們日常測試過程中經常需要抓取網絡包,查看上下行的數據是否正確。抓取移動設備上的網絡包的通常思路是在pc機上打開抓包工具,然后讓移動設備走pc的代理上網,從而在pc上抓取移動設備的網絡包。 Charles和fiddler是經常用到的2款抓包神器。 然而在實際工作中經常有小伙伴產生 ...
okhttp 中是自帶websocket 服務的,網上的教程也非常多。但是很多都沒有注明關鍵一步,需要引入 'com.squareup.okhttp3:okhttp-ws:3.4.2' 才可以調用webscoket 對象, 先定義一個靜態的全局okhttp對象,方便以后調用 ...
淘寶的頁面大量使用了js加載數據,所以采用selenium來進行爬取更為簡單,selenum作為一個測試工具,主要配合無窗口瀏覽器phantomjs來使用。 ...
部門需要一個自動化腳本,完成web端界面功能的冒煙,並且需要抓取加載頁面時的ajax請求,從接口層面判斷請求是否成功。查閱了很多資料都沒有人有過相關問題的處理經驗,在處理過程中也踩了很多坑,所以如果你也有這個需要,就繼續往下看吧~ 環境及語言: Python selenium ...
使用RestTemplate,顯示請求信息,響應信息 這里不講怎么用RestTemplate具體細節用法,就是一個學習中的過程記錄 一個簡單的例子 運行結果: ❓:現在我想看看他的請求頭,請求參數,響應頭,響應體的詳細信息是怎么樣子的,這樣也方便以后檢查請求參數是否完整,響應正確 ...